Lighthouse “Care Kit” List for August 4 Thank you for your willingness to bless LCM clients by providing “Care Kit” items! LCM has clients who regularly come in hungry, are homeless, or have no resources to prepare food. Your contribution is greatly appreciated! The items below will make FOUR Day Packs & is estimated at $25 total. Lighthouse will provide the bags. 1 Box Saltines (4 sleeves of crackers) 1 four-pack fruit cups (easy open) 1 pack Jif-to-Go peanut butter (4-8 pk, 1-2 per bag) 4 cans tuna or chicken (with pull top) 4 cans vienna sausages (with pull top) 1 box pop-tarts 1 pack Hunts Pudding Cups (non-refrigerated) 1 box granola bars (protein bars, etc) 4 bottles of water 4 travel size Wet Wipes 4 pk of breath mints or lifesavers
